The illustrious career of goaltending great Terry Sawchuk came to a tragic end soon after the 1969-70 season, when a scuffle with New York Rangers teammate Ron Stewart resulted in internal injuries that led to his death at the young age of 40. Considered among the very best at his position in hockey history, Sawchuk finished with 447 wins and 103 shutouts, both NHL records at the time, and was posthumously elected to the Hockey Hall of Fame in 1971. 1969-70 was his only year with the Rangers, and he appeared in just eight games, making his autograph from that season particularly scarce. Offered here is a complete, 72 page Ex condition Madison Square Garden program from the 1968-69 season that has been autographed on its cover by virtually the entire 1969-70 New York team, led by Sawchuk's sharp signature in the center. 17 autographs in total include the "GAG" line of Vic Hadfield and HOF'ers Rod Gilbert and Jean Ratelle; plus Stewart, Emile Francis, Ed Giacomin, Balon, Tkaczuk, Fairbairn, Nevin, Kurtenbach, Marshall, Brown, Seiling, Widing and Lemieux.
